WebMaternal health: Breastfeeding also protects mothers from breast and ovarian cancers and heart disease. Relationship-building: Breastfeeding supports the mother-baby relationship and the mental health of both baby and mother. Web1425 Words6 Pages. The ability to communicate effectively is essential when referring to the health and social care sector. Communication implies much more than transferring and receiving information. It represents a vital part in developing and maintaining relationships and everyone uses it as a method to express feelings and emotions.
